Here is the code

/**********************************************/
       var myhash = new Object();

        myhash.start = time;
        myhash.end = time;
        myhash.latestStart = time;
        myhash.earliestEnd =
time;
        myhash.instant = true;
        myhash.text = title;
        myhash.description = uri;

        var evt = new Timeline.DefaultEventSource.Event(myhash);
        eventSource.add(evt);
/**********************************************/
